Ingredients
Jojoba Oil (Simmondsia chinensis), Olive Oil (Olea europaea), and Sweet Almond Oil (Prunus amygdalus dulcis) infused with Lemon Balm (Melissa officinalis), Chamomile (Matricaria recutita), Cleavers (Galium aparine), Linden Flower (Tilia spp.), Lavender (Lavandula angustifolia), and Spruce (Picea spp.); Unrefined Shea Butter (Butyrospermum parkii); Goat Tallow (Capra hircus); Beeswax (Cera alba); Lavender Oil (Lavandula angustifolia); Cedarwood Oil (Cedrus atlantica or Juniperus virginiana); Frankincense Oil (Boswellia spp.); Vetiver Oil (Vetiveria zizanioides); Sweet Orange Oil (Citrus sinensis).
Warnings
For external use only. Avoid contact with eyes and mucous membranes. Discontinue use if irritation or sensitivity occurs. Contains chamomile (Asteraceae family); avoid use if allergic to ragweed or related plants. Contains essential oils; use as directed and avoid if sensitive. Contains tree nut derivatives (sweet almond oil, shea butter). Consult a healthcare provider before use if pregnant, nursing, or managing a medical condition. This product is intended for cosmetic use only and is not intended to diagnose, treat, cure, or prevent any disease.
